Another possible contributing factor making the high less enjoyable is CBN levels:
Quote Originally Posted by http://www.a1b2c3.com/drugs/mj028.htm

CBN (Cannabinol) is produced as THC ages and breaks down, this process is known as oxidization. High levels of CBN tend to make the user feel messed up rather than high.

CBN levels can be kept to a minimum by storing cannabis products in a dark, cool, airtight environment. Marijuana should be dry prior to storage, and may have to be dried again after being stored somewhere that is humid.
